role overview
the icu rmo is responsible for providing continuous medical care to critically ill patients, assisting consultants, and managing day-to-day icu operations in a structured hospital environment. the role demands clinical expertise, quick decision-making, and adherence to standardized protocols for patient safety and quality care.
________________________________________
key responsibilities
• monitor critically ill patients, assess vital signs, and promptly report clinical changes to icu consultants.
• initiate basic emergency interventions and support advanced life-saving procedures under supervision.
• assist in intubation, extubation, central line insertion, arterial line monitoring, and other icu procedures.
• manage ventilator settings, oxygen therapy, and infusion medications as per icu protocols.
• coordinate with nursing staff, perfusionists, and allied healthcare professionals for integrated patient care.
• document patient history, icu observations, interventions, and treatment plans accurately.
• participate in code blue, rapid response, and resuscitation efforts.
• review lab results, abg, ecg, and imaging reports to support clinical decision-making.
• ensure compliance with hospital safety, infection control, and quality protocols.
• liaise with patient families regarding care updates, treatment plans, and progress.
